H5 how can the mobile end cut out the special characters after entering them, or cannot enter the special characters at all?

this is my code can be perfectly implemented on the PC side, but when I enter a special character for the first time on the mobile side, I will not cut any character for the second time. Or is there any other better way to ask for advice!

Mar.09,2021

there are no keyboard events on mobile, so you can change it to @ touchstart

.
MySQL Query : SELECT * FROM `codeshelper`.`v9_news` WHERE status=99 AND catid='6' ORDER BY rand() LIMIT 5
MySQL Error : Disk full (/tmp/#sql-temptable-64f5-1bf36d9-31e65.MAI); waiting for someone to free some space... (errno: 28 "No space left on device")
MySQL Errno : 1021
Message : Disk full (/tmp/#sql-temptable-64f5-1bf36d9-31e65.MAI); waiting for someone to free some space... (errno: 28 "No space left on device")
Need Help?